The type of guilt (remorse for misdeed) felt when capture/punishment is imminent. It's not that the misdeed itself is regretted due to realization that it was wrong, but only because the person is unwilling/unable to accept the consequences. Term comes from the colloquial and the legal system ("felon").
The thief was not sorry she stole; but was very, very sorry she was going to prison.
